Last update: 11 hours agoUS Visa Overhaul for Africa: From Aug 1, 2026, the U.S. will stop routine visa processing at 25 African posts, including Nouakchott, and route applicants to regional hubs such as Dakar, Abidjan, Accra, Cape Town, Johannesburg, Lagos, and Nairobi—a shift aimed at standardising screening and security. Atlantic Route Tragedy Off Mauritania: UNHCR says at least 143 refugees and migrants are missing or presumed dead after a boat from The Gambia sank off Mauritania; 38 survivors were rescued near Nouadhibou after 25 days at sea, highlighting the deadly smuggling route to Europe’s Canary Islands. Passport Mobility Watch: Morocco ranks 67th globally (visa-free access to 71 destinations), while Mauritania sits at 83rd; the Henley Passport Index also shows Nigeria at 90th with access to 44 destinations. Regional Travel Context: Lebanon’s visa-on-arrival list for tourists includes Mauritania (plus 12 other African countries), but travellers must meet strict border requirements like proof of onward travel, accommodation, and $2,000 in funds.
